Hamden In Top 5 of Girls Basketball Preseason Poll
Sports media members and coaches have selected the top 10 girls high school teams in Connecticut to start the 2018-19 season.

HAMDEN, CT — Defending Class LL Mercy topped the preseason balloting of sports media members and coaches in the first high school girls basketball poll of the 2018-19 season.
The Tigers garnered 11 of 18 first-place votes to edge 2018 Class M champion East Haven, with New London winding up third.
Hamden collected three first-place votes in finishing fifth.

Here are the top 10, with first-place votes in parentheses, plus all other teams receiving votes.
- Mercy (11)
- East Haven
- New London (1)
- Trumbull (2)
- Hamden (3)
- Daniel Hand
- Hall
- RHAM
- Farmington (1)
- Coginchaug
Also receiving votes: Norwalk, Stamford, Career Magnet, Notre Dame-Fairfield, Simsbury, Enfield, Cromwell, Newtown, St. Paul, Trinity Catholic, SMSA, Wethersfield, Bacon Academy, Southington, Capital Prep, Berlin, Bethel, Fairfield Warde, Norwich Free Academy, Ridgefield, E.O. Smith, Staples, Amity, Windsor, Rocky Hill, Weston, East Lyme, Fairfield Ludlowe, Canton, Sacred Heart, Waterford.
